‘Near Me’ is the Here and Now: Why local SEO matters for service businesses.
When people need a plumber, dentist or auto repair shop, they search with intent, urgency and location in mind.
“Emergency plumber near me.”
“Brake repair nearby.”
“Dentist open now.”
And the business that shows up often gets the call. Simple, right? Only if your local SEO is working in your favor.
The Power of the Map Pack
One of the most valuable spots in all of local search is the Google Map Pack, the map and business listings that appear near the top of local search results.
Customers trust it because it quickly provides the information they need to make a decision: reviews, ratings, hours, location and contact information. For service businesses, showing up consistently can directly impact calls, appointments and website traffic.
More importantly, it creates familiarity. When customers repeatedly see your business appear in local searches, trust starts building before they ever contact you.
“Near Me” Searches Continue to Grow
High-intent searches from customers actively looking for someone local they can trust right now are golden. You want to show up for those.
Google prioritizes businesses that provide strong local signals through optimized Google Business Profiles, localized website content, accurate business information and strong reviews. If your business is not optimized locally, you may be invisible during the exact moments customers are ready to buy.
Reviews Aren’t Just a Nice to Have
For many customers, reviews have become the first consultation before they ever contact a business.
Businesses with consistent reviews, strong ratings and active responses often perform better in local search because Google sees them as more trustworthy and relevant. Customers do too.
In service industries especially, trust matters. Customers are inviting you into their homes, businesses, healthcare decisions or legal matters. Your online reputation now plays a major role in whether they choose you or keep searching.
Local SEO Is More Than Keywords
Focusing on a review strategy without enhancing your web content or optimizing your Google Business Profile won’t get you very far. Everything plays off each other:
- Google Business Profile optimization
- Location-specific content
- Mobile website performance
- Review strategy
- Technical SEO
- Service-area optimization
These elements help search engines understand who you are, where you work and when your business should appear in local searches.
AI Is Changing Local Search Too
Customers are increasingly asking AI tools for local recommendations and service information. And those tools pull from the same ecosystem local SEO influences: websites, reviews, business profiles and localized content. Which means strong local SEO is no longer just about ranking in Google. It is about positioning your business to be discovered however customers choose to search next.
Local SEO is visibility, credibility and familiarity. When customers repeatedly see your business in the Map Pack, across local search results and through reviews and localized content, you become recognizable before the first phone call ever happens.
And, as you know, familiarity often drives the decision.
